Factors Influencing Commercial Vehicle Wrap Pricing

Vehicle wraps can be a major investment for businesses looking to boost brand awareness.

The cost of a commercial vehicle wrap can fluctuate based on a number of factors. Some of the key factors that affect pricing include the size of the asset, the complexity of the design, the kind of vinyl used, and the expertise of the installer.

Additional aspects that can affect pricing include the region where the wrap is placed, the quantity of vehicles being wrapped, and any supplemental services required, such as design.

It's important to receive quotes from multiple companies to evaluate pricing and services before making a decision.

Maximize Your ROI: The True Cost for a Commercial Vehicle Wrap

Investing in a commercial vehicle wrap is a strategic move that can dramatically boost your brand visibility and generate significant return on investment (ROI). However, it's crucial to understand the true cost embedded with this decision. While the initial sticker price might seem attractive, several factors influence the overall expense.

Premium vinyl offers superior durability, color preservation, and resistance to fading, ensuring a long-lasting presentation. Secondly, factor in the complexity for the design. Intricate graphics and custom components often require more time and expertise from skilled designers and installers, increasing the cost.

Furthermore, the size and type of your vehicle will also affect the wrap's price. Larger vehicles with complex contours typically require more material and labor, resulting in a higher investment. Don't overlook the importance of professional installation as well. A poorly installed wrap can lead to air bubbles, peeling, and overall aesthetic issues, ultimately diminishing your ROI.
